Description

The Receiver of the Pcnautic Autopilot Remote Control can be connected via the USB plug to the ControlHead.

If you are already using the USB, you can use a regular 2.0 USB hub to expand the number of connections.

For a waterproof connection to the ControlHead, the Receiver is also available with a waterproof USB plug.

 

8 Button Pcnautic Remote:

When operating via the remote, you will hear a beep from the ControlHead for confirmation with each key.

< function is equivalent to the port arrow on the ControlHead:

In standby mode the rod retracts and by keeping the button pressed it goes faster and faster.

In Auto mode -1 when pressed, first -5 degrees consecutively +10 degrees each time up to a maximum of 100 degrees.

> function is equivalent to the starboard arrow on the ControlHead:

In standby mode the rod extends, by keeping the button pressed it goes faster and faster.

In Auto mode +1 when pressed, first +5 degrees consecutively, each time +10 degrees up to a maximum of 100 degrees.

The << function is the same as the < key in standby mode

<< function in Auto mode -10

<< function in Tack mode -5

>> function is the same as the > key in standby mode

>> function in Auto mode +10

>> function in Tack mode +5

M/mode function changes the heading source if wind and/or GPS data is available.

T/Tack function is the same as Tack Mode on the Controlhead, as long as tack mode is on you can tack with the single arrow keys.

To disable tack mode, press T/tack again

You can also tack directly without tack mode by simultaneously pressing < and A/auto for tacking to port and by simultaneously pressing > and S/standby to starboard.

S/standby function is Standby

A/ auto function is Auto-mode / Auto follow mode

 

Basic Remote 

4 button Basic Remote with A,B,C and D

When operating via the remote, you will hear a beep from the ControlHead for confirmation with each key.

A function is equivalent to the port arrow on the ControlHead:

In standby mode the rod retracts and by keeping the button pressed it goes faster and faster.

In Auto mode -1 when pressed, first -5 degrees consecutively +10 degrees each time up to a maximum of 100 degrees.

B function is equivalent to the starboard arrow on the ControlHead:

In standby mode the rod extends, by keeping the button pressed it goes faster and faster.

In Auto mode +1 when pressed, first +5 degrees consecutively, each time +10 degrees up to a maximum of 100 degrees.

C function is Standby

D function is Auto mode / Auto follow mode

The following functions are available by pressing keys simultaneously:

A+C=-10, B+D=+10, A+B=Mode, C+D=Tack mode, A+D=direct tack port and B+C=direct tack starboard.

Support

  • Both remote controls are equipped with a 23A 12V battery.

It is expected that it will last for at least several years, if necessary it can be replaced by unscrewing the housing.

  • You can also add multiple remote controls to your receiver.

Unscrew the receiver, insert the USB plug so that the receiver is on.

Press the programming button once (the LED lights up), press any key on the remote control you wish to add, the LED then flashes a few times to indicate that the remote control has been added.
